I hit a new plateau today driving to work; at approximately 4:55 AM Eastern time, I wiped out my TENTH north American white tailed deer. Using a vehicle.
It's the seventh I've taken with one of my personal vehicles; the other three were on the clock. And today's was one of the scariest, because my Escort is the smallest vehicle I've ever owned. I would have to say the car did well; only a trashed fender and headlight pod, some wrinkling to the corner of the hood. It's still drivable (unlike the other milestone day, where I hit two of the @*%% things in a 45 minute period, with the Sheriffs deputy who took the first report catching the trailing view of the second with her dash cam. That poor van went home on a wrecker after that.).
